Proactive Uptime with the NXB-SNS-342-005 Vibration Sensor

Unexpected downtime is the enemy of productivity. A robotic joint failure can halt an entire production line, leading to costly delays and repairs. Predictive maintenance (PdM) offers a powerful solution, shifting the paradigm from reactive fixes to proactive intervention. The key to any successful PdM strategy is high-quality data, and that's precisely where the NexBot Robotics 342-005 Vibration Sensor excels.

This high-precision piezoelectric sensor is designed specifically for monitoring the health of robot joints, motors, and gearboxes. Its primary strength lies in its exceptionally wide frequency range of 10 Hz to 10 kHz. This isn't just a technical specification; it's a critical capability. Low-frequency vibrations can indicate issues like misalignment or imbalance, while high-frequency signatures often provide the earliest warnings of bearing wear or gear tooth defects. By capturing this full spectrum, the NXB-SNS-342-005 allows maintenance teams to detect subtle anomalies long before they escalate into catastrophic failures.

Integration is streamlined through the industry-standard IO-Link protocol and 24VDC power. This allows the sensor to communicate rich diagnostic data directly to a plant's control system, providing real-time insights into machine health. Instead of adhering to a rigid, time-based maintenance schedule, technicians can service assets based on their actual condition, maximizing component life and minimizing production interruptions.

Unbreakable Connections: The NXB-CBL-531-005 M23 Connector

A sensor's data is worthless if it can't be transmitted reliably. Industrial environments are notoriously harsh, filled with vibration, dust, moisture, and temperature fluctuations that can compromise standard electrical connections. The NexBot Robotics 531-005 M23 12-Pin Circular Connector is engineered to thrive in these demanding conditions.

Built for high-reliability applications, this connector provides a secure and stable link for power and data. The M23 form factor is a trusted standard in industrial automation for its robust, screw-on locking mechanism that resists vibration and accidental disconnection. Its IP67 rating provides complete assurance against dust ingress and protection from temporary water immersion, making it ideal for washdown environments or facilities with airborne particulates.

With 12 pins, a 48VDC voltage rating, and compatibility with protocols like PROFINET, the NXB-CBL-531-005 is versatile enough to handle complex signals from advanced sensors, actuators, and network devices. Whether connecting a vibration sensor on a fast-moving robotic arm or linking a safety device to the central controller, this connector ensures that critical signals maintain their integrity, preventing data loss and phantom faults that can be difficult to troubleshoot.

The Guardian of the Work Cell: NXB-GEN-631-006 Pressure Safety Mat

As robotic systems become more powerful and collaborative, ensuring operator safety is paramount. While uptime and reliability are crucial for business, protecting personnel is a non-negotiable responsibility. The NexBot Drives 631-006 Pressure Safety Mat serves as a frontline defense in creating a safe robotic work cell.

These mats establish a defined safety zone around a robot or automated machinery. When an operator steps onto the mat, the pressure change is instantly detected, sending a signal to the robot's safety controller to stop motion or revert to a safe speed. This provides a simple, intuitive, and highly effective safeguarding method that protects personnel during maintenance, programming, or material handling tasks near the machine.
